Alessandro has announced the upcoming conversion of his songs through animated limited edition NFTs
The growing role of NFTs in transforming music and art is revolutionizing the space as more artists and musicians embrace the change. Alessandro Safina has joined this growing list by announcing the launch of his limited NFT collection that was created in partnership with Disindex. Alessandro opines that this new reality redefines the timelessness of music and other art forms.
Designed by Disindex, a company specializing in designing distributed and decentralized digital strategies, only 33 “Safina Friends” NFTs will ever be minted. The launch will entail a five-day auction where people get to bid to win one of the limited animated collections—the NFTs act as digital passes that will allow holders access to Alessandro’s exclusive community. There is also a suite of benefits that holders of these NFTs will experience, like getting to write and produce songs with him and earning part of the royalties, meeting him, receiving a free NFT airdrop from the “Safina ART” collection, have lunch or dinner together, get free tickets for his next concerts, hear his unreleased songs before anyone else and much more.
“Two auctions will launch at the same time, one will be an internal auction, directly through the project site, and one will take course on Opensea marketplace. The internal auction will allow its top bidders to win 30 NFTs (of which 1 Platinum, 9 Gold, and 20 Loyal) while 3 NFTs will be auctioned through Opensea (1 Platinum, 1 Gold and 1 Loyal).”
The first 13 platinum or gold bidders for this limited collection will receive a physical special platinum/gold award – “a limited edition of course, which will be personally autographed by Alessandro Safina and engraved with your full name.” The Platinum Safina Friends NFT access pass also guarantees co-production of a song with Alessandro and earning 50% of the royalties or having a private mini concert. Platinum holders also get a one-on-one meeting, unlimited free tickets, full access to community meetings, unlimited access to the private web area and premium VIP assistance.
Premium VIP assistance is availed to all “Safina Friends” NFT holders, allowing them a direct communication channel with the staff. Holders will also receive remote connection for resolution of any technical problems like NFT management, wallet configuration and other requests with guaranteed response times of 24 hours.
Part of the proceeds from the auctions will go to a charity association in support of war victims, the specific charity will be communicated on the website.
The much-anticipated launch is slotted for some time in April. People can keep abreast with updates on this collection by following the countdown on the project website and subscribing to the mailing list to get whitelisted.
About Alessandro Safina
Alessandro Safina is a crossover tenor artist from Italy and one of the three greatest world tenors of pop opera as named by CNN. Alessandro’s career has seen him revolutionize classical music to suit a more modern audience without giving up on his love for it. Alessandro has drawn inspiration from the legendary tenor, Enrico Caruso, and other artists like Depeche Mode, U2, The Clash, and Genesis. Over the course of his career, he has evolved to combine classical music and pop, creating a soulful new pop opera music. Alessandro has worked with artists like Elton John, Sarah Brightman, Rod Stewart, Andrea Bocelli, and more. He is also the recipient of various awards nominations and is recognized worldwide for his contribution to the heritage of music.
